Indonesia is consistently one of the world’s top five markets for YouTube watch time. Local creators have built massive followings by producing content that resonates with Indonesian daily life, humor, and aspirations.
What defines this new era is agency. The Indonesian audience, particularly its young majority, is no longer a spectator but a participant, a critic, and a creator. The popular video is not just a product; it is a conversation—often loud, sometimes crude, but always authentically Indonesian.
